Saginaw outlasts Rangers, 3-2
The Saginaw Spirit beat the Kitchener Rangers in a 3-2 shootout Saturday night at a sold out Dow Event Center of Saginaw. The win completes a Stanley Steemer Clean Sweep, and gives the Spirit an OHL West Division leading 72 points and 34-16-3-1 record. Saginaw’s John McFarland was the first star of the game with an assist and the game winning shootout goal.
SAGINAW --
Spirit winger Anthony Camara started off the scoring with his sixth goal of the season a minute forty-five into the game. Defenseman Brad Walch tallied the lone assist on the goal. The Rangers would respond on the power play, with defenseman Jamie Doornbosch scoring at the 4:40 mark from winger Jerry D’Amigo and winger Jason Akeson. The Spirit came out ahead at the end of the first period however, with center Vincent Trocheck scoring a power play goal at 15:53 from defenseman Peter Hermenegildo and center John McFarland. The first period would end 2-1, with the Rangers making it a tied effort in the final seconds of the second period. Rangers captain Gabriel Landeskog scored an unassisted goal at 19:38 to tie up the game.
The teams battled through a scoreless third period and 4-on-4 overtime before squaring off in a shootout. The first two rounds missed their mark, with Garret Ross and Vincent Trocheck unable to put a tally on the score sheet and Spirit goalie Mavric Parks stopping efforts from Michael Catenacci and Jerry D’Amigo. The Spirit secure the 3-2 win after McFarland tallied the lone shootout goal and Parks stoned Ryan Murphy.
Spirit goalie Mavric Parks tallied 30 saves on 32 shots and Rangers goalie Brandon Maxwell tallied 36 saves on 38 shots.
